Tipperary manager Liam Sheedy has made a host of changes for Sunday's Allianz League clash with Westmeath in Nenagh.

The All-Ireland champions haven't featured in the league since February 1 when they suffered their second defeat of the campaign to Cork at Pairc Ui Chaoimh while last weekend's round 3 clash with Galway was postponed due to the poor weather conditions.

Reigning Hurler of the Year Seamus Callanan has been named at full forward for the visit of the Lake County to MacDonagh Park.

Tipperary (Allianz HL Division 1 v Westmeath): Brian Hogan; Cathal Barrett, Barry Heffernan, Sean O’Brien; Seamus Kennedy, Ronan Maher, Bryan O’Meara; Alan Flynn, Michael Breen; Mark Kehoe, Niall O’Meara, Cian Darcy; Jason Forde, Seamus Callanan, Jake Morris.

Subs: Barry Hogan, Paddy Cadell, Jerome Cahill, Paul Flynn, Paul Maher, Brian McGrath, John McGrath, Noel McGrath, Craig Moran, Joe O’Dwyer, Dillon Quirke.
